    NY struggles with this all the time…..we want to promote what we do but if everything we do is available for "free" hard to justify (with some) the advantages of joining.   We are transitioning to a "free" newsletter on our website, lots of advocacy tools on our website, BUT making the "fee based" events have a discrepancy between member/non.   Likewise, we are working on advocacy tools that promote the responsibility of membership, professional associations, and leadership.   Personally I think the decisions to join or not comes down to a person's intrinsic sense of "duty" to do so and often hard to shift the way people decide.   Our job is  to make it hard to say "NO" !   Do share any updates/views that have increased membership…always our goal.  Thanks, Sue Kowalski

    We have struggled with this question. Currently:

    • You can only receive the list of members if you are a member
    • We also have scholarships and awards that are available to members only
    • Conference registration is less expensive if you are a member (we have looked at the model our state technology organization uses which is: higher conference fee that includes the price of membership)

    Everything else is free to whoever visits our site. We would like to offer more that is member only for added benefit of membership, but find it expensive to create a member only "locked" area on a website. We found that when we had a link we distributed to members (say Google docs), people would still pass that on to non-members. So. We decided to stop fighting that trend and simply open things up. Hopefully those non-members that use our site will see the good things we do, and opt to join.
